Poetry. "Tim Skeen's John Ciardi Prize-winning collection reveals a distanced compassion so keen it might draw blood from his readers. He retells our hard histories, men and women at work in dangerous and impossible circumstances--labor wars, poverty, early death, disease, and violence--to cry out to his beloved, "How can you want children/in spite of the ossuaries of this world?" KENTUCKY SWAMI answers the question by moving in close, the poems a vibrant celebration of our continuing lives. This book is marvelous!"--Hilda Raz
